Media: Even HIV and hepatitis patients are recruited to the Wagner PMC
The AFU captured a Wagnerian with HIV and hepatitis.
The occupant was shot in the arm - he started bleeding, which in the presence of HIV and hepatitis is very dangerous for others, the Obozrevatel writes .
The prisoner said that before being sent to the front, the sick occupants had also undergone medical examinations, but there were no reasons for not allowing them.
The captive stated that he went to serve in order to get out of prison early - he has 10 years left to serve.
The occupant also said that many emigrants from Central Asia were enrolling in the Wagner PMC: they were going to fight in order to obtain citizenship.
